Ingredients
– 1/2 pound (225 grams) elbow macaroni
– 3 tablespoons (43 grams) butter
– 2 tablespoons (16 grams) all-purpose flour
– 1/2 teaspoon salt
– 1/8 teaspoon ground black pepper
– 1 1/2 cups (360 ml) milk
– 3/4 cup (180 ml) half and half
– 2 1/2 cups (250 grams) shredded cheddar cheese preferably aged for better flavor
Instructions
1-Prepare all ingredients by measuring them out first, then cook the elbow macaroni in boiling salted water until itβs slightly under al dente, which takes about 7-8 minutes, and drain it.
2-In a medium saucepan over medium heat, melt the 3 tablespoons of butter, then whisk in the 2 tablespoons of flour, 1/2 teaspoon of salt, and 1/8 teaspoon of ground black pepper, cooking for about 2 minutes to form a smooth roux.
3-Gradually add the 1 1/2 cups of milk and 3/4 cup of half and half, stirring constantly until the mixture thickens to a gravy-like consistency, about 5-7 minutes.
4-Remove the saucepan from heat and slowly stir in 1 cup of the shredded cheddar cheese, letting it melt gently without over-stirring to avoid graininess.
5-Combine the cheese sauce with the cooked macaroni, then pour half of the mixture into your prepared baking dish, sprinkle with 1/2 cup of cheese, add the remaining mixture, and top with the rest of the cheese.
6-Bake for 15-20 minutes until itβs bubbly and golden on top. For dietary variations, substitute ingredients like using gluten-free pasta in the first step.

π§ Use high-quality aged cheddar and freshly grated cheese at room temperature for best melt.
π₯ Melt cheese gently over low heat to avoid graininess in sauce.
π Optional: add toppings like parmesan, buttery breadcrumbs, or cooked bacon for extra texture and flavor.
